The attached packaging builds the first post-branch
snapshot of gcc 4.2. It should be able to build gcc,
g++, objc and gfortran as multilib on both ppc and intel.
The libffi and libjava multilib builds are disabled since
they don't work properly in gcc 4.2. We may want to
fork the gcc4 package
